Industry Insulation is the most important aspect to consider when selecting suitable sites to build PV power plants. Average solar radiation in Saudi Arabia varies between a maximum of 7.004 kWh/m 2 at Bisha and a minimum of 4.479 kWh/m 2 at Tabuk (Fig. 3). Industry Types of Solar Panels - First Generation Solar Cells. First-generation solar cells, primarily based on crystalline silicon technology, represent the most established and widely used technology in the solar industry. These cells are known for their high efficiency, durability, and extensive use in both residential and commercial solar power systems.

Industry Charge Controllers. A charge controller is a device that manages the flow of electricity from your solar panels to a battery. A solar charge controller is another optional component, and if you don''t have a battery in your system, you won''t need a charge controller. Charge controllers work to ensure the batteries in your system are charged to an optional level

Industry Figure 1: Illustration - How Solar Panels Work, A Solar PV Inverter is a major component of the Photovoltaic System. It is an electrical device that combines mechanical and electronic circuitry in changing or converting DC (fed in from the solar panels), to AC, . Industry Solar panels generate DC electricity, which is not suitable for most household appliances that operate on AC. Inverters play a vital role in this transition, ensuring that the electricity produced by solar panels can be effectively used in homes and businesses, maximizing energy efficiency and usability.
